**Step 7 — PickPath signing key rotation.** Okay, this is the big one. Before we cut the new release of the Brindlewood pick-list optimizer, gather the three keyholders (Mira, Tobin, and whoever's covering for Sal) in the ceremony room. Rotate the signing key, verify the checksum out loud, and log it in the ledger. Once everyone nods, record the recovery passphrase exactly as read below.

unlock words, yagag-yahog: gordor-zorvan-druius-queniel-normir-norwyn-framir-novmir-ralius-holwyn-wenwyn-tamael-silok-holdor

### Step 4 — Enable fan-out backpressure

Pushpipe's notification fan-out now sheds load instead of queueing unbounded. Before flipping the flag, drain the legacy dispatcher and confirm consumer lag under 5k. Backpressure kicks in per-shard; slow subscribers get deferred, not dropped. Don't tune limits ad hoc — changes go through Renko's review. Apply the standard configuration shown below.

config for kawif-hahig:
zorix:
  log_level: error
  metrics_host: metrics.zorix.lumiclabs.internal
  pool_size: 16

## Welcome to Murmurstone On-Call

Hey! Murmurstone powers the audio guides at the Fennick Gallery app, and you're now holding the pager. Most incidents are stale tour manifests — just re-run the sync job. If the content vault itself locks up (rare, but it happens), you'll need to unseal it manually. The passphrase for that is right below this line.

vault phrase of yawig-bawig = fenael-norael-eliox-gilox-casath-druath-zorys-istwyn-jorwyn